With the help of 3D printing technology, doctors in Shanghai have separated three-month-old twin sisters who were conjoined at the hip. The twins, born in east China&`&s Jiangxi Province, were connected by soft tissues at the lower spine. They had mostly separate digestive systems but shared one lower bowel. After a five hour operation in the Children&`&s Hospital of Fudan University, the twins were separated, and had their organs and muscles reconstructed. Doctors used 3D printing to build two models simulating the structure of the twins&`& connected parts, which helped them better understand case. Since 2000, doctors at the hospital have successfully separated seven pairs of conjoined twins. This is NEWS Plus Special English. Nine people have been detained in Jiangxi Province, east China, for posing as other students and sitting the "Gaokao", or college entrance exam. Local police said one of the suspects, 20-year-old surnamed Peng, is a college student in Wuhan, central China&`&s Hubei Province. Peng has confessed to the police and provided the information of five other substitute exam sitters. Peng and the other substitutes were organized by another suspect surnamed Zhao who hails from Shandong Province in east China. Zhao arranged accommodation for Peng and the others and supplied the exam passes. The scam was exposed by a reporter who had gone undercover as an exam substitute. The first suspect was caught on the first day of the exam. Over 9.4 million high school students sat for the Gaokao from June 7 to 9. Public security authorities across the country were working to clamp down on cheating activities including the distribution of wireless devices, and the practice of substitute exam sitters. This is NEWS Plus Special English. Shanghai will lower its exit and entry threshold on July 1 to attract overseas talent by adding 12 programs to the latest brain gain list. Overseas personnel introduced by the program will enjoy preferential policies in visa applications, residence permits, doing business in China, as well as exit and entry convenience. The new programs will be market oriented, transparent and more efficient. Shanghai also encourages overseas students graduated from Chinese universities to work or start a business in Shanghai. Local authorities promised to extend the period of validity of visas held by foreign business people and offer them favorable policies. The new programs also aim to improve service standards for overseas personnel during their entry, transit and residing in Shanghai. You are listening to NEWS Plus Special English. Chinese scientists have completed sequencing the genome of the first case of imported Middle East Respiratory Syndrome, or MERS, and found no evidence of variation that makes the virus more contagious. The genome map of the virus shows high homology with the MERS virus detected in the Middle East. Scientists believe the strain originated in Saudi Arabia. The result of the sequencing has been uploaded to GenBank at National Center for Biotechnology Information in the United States. By testing and comparing genome sequence of different strains, scientists may find effective measures to prevent the spread of the disease, which has a fatality rate of 40 percent.
